Evidence-based Efficacy Of High-intensity Focused Ultrasound Hifu In Visual Body Contouring An overall of 24 patients with bust cancer cells undertook HIFU therapy 1-- 2 weeks before obtaining modified radical mastectomy. During and after HIFU therapy, modifications in blood pressure, breath, pulse and outer blood oxygen saturation were checked. At the exact same time, the damages of the skin and tissue created by HIFU at the target region was assessed as well. Surgically excised samples were made use of for pathological evaluations to assess the HIFU-induced destruction of the targeted cells.

The mean prostate-specific antigen nadir adhering to aesthetically routed focal HIFU was 2.2 ng/ml (95% CI 0.9-- 3.5 ng/ml), accomplished after a median of 6 months post-treatment. A medically significant favorable biopsy was identified in 19.8% (95% CI 12.4-- 28.3%) of situations. Salvage therapy rates were 16.2% (95% CI 9.7-- 23.8%) for focal- or whole-gland therapy, and 8.6% (95% CI 6.1-- 11.5%) for whole-gland treatment. In all researches, a lipid panel, liver enzymes, medical chemistry, hematology and coagulation profiles, and creatine phosphokinase with isoenzymes were gotten from all people before treatment and throughout follow-up sees. In Research study 1, blood examples were gotten from the first 21 patients prior to treatment and after that at one, two, three, 4, seven, 28, and 56 days after therapy. Blood examples were acquired from the staying patients prior to therapy and at one and three months adhering to treatment. A high-sensitivity C-reactive healthy protein examination was carried out in 16 individuals.
